Article: Buddy Holly grows to mythic proportion: New biography upstages the truth.(Metropolitan Times)(Arts & Entertainment)(Book Review)

Texas Monthly magazine got it right when it declared last fall, "Buddy Holly Is Alive!"

The Lubbock-born beanpole boy wonder, who died Feb. 3, 1959, in an Iowa plane crash that snuffed out a brief but revolutionary rock 'n' roll career, is in full resurrection right now.

Glorified in an Oscar-nominated 1978 biopic, Holly has returned as the latest target of the tribute-album craze, "Not Fade Away," released in December and featuring, among others, Holly protege Waylon Jennings. He is the centerpiece of a new hometown museum and, finally, the subject of a new biography that had people buzzing - and fuming - even before its release.
